Regulatory Framework and Legal Considerations

The legal landscape around online gambling in South Korea is complicated. While traditional land-based casinos are legal, online gambling platforms face tighter restrictions. The government enforces strict regulations, making it illegal for most local residents to participate in online gambling services offered by foreign casinos.

However, there are exceptions. Some forms of online gaming, such as sports betting and lottery services, are regulated and operate under government oversight. Despite this, the proliferation of unregulated foreign online casinos continues to be a challenge for authorities as many South Koreans seek to avoid restrictive laws.

Societal Impacts of Online Gambling

As online casinos become more prevalent in society, it is essential to consider the social implications they carry. While many people enjoy online gambling as a form of recreation, there are concerns regarding problem gambling. The government and organizations like the Korean Center on Gambling Problems are working diligently to promote responsible gambling practices and provide support for those affected.

Moreover, the rise of online casinos has created debates around the need for further regulation and oversight. This ongoing discussion aims to balance the economic benefits that online casinos bring versus the potential for social issues related to gambling addiction.
